			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Chennai is the capital of Tamil Nadu and a bustling city and a popular hub for travellers. Just a few hours from Chennai are some exceptional hill stations and cities where you can enjoy divine scenery, weather and history. We bring you six locations that are convenient and beautiful weekend getaways from Chennai.</p>
<p><strong><a href="http://www.mahindrahomestays.com/homestays/Pages/coorg.aspx">Coorg</a>:</strong> Nestled in south-west Karnataka lies Coorg, a small hillstation that’s often called ‘The Scotland of the East’.</p>
<p><a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/File:Tadiandamol_Pan.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-4060" title="800px-Tadiandamol_Pan" src="http://blog.mahindrahomestays.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/12/800px-Tadiandamol_Pan.jpg" alt="800px-Tadiandamol_Pan" width="350" height="157" /></a></p>
<p><strong><a href="http://www.mahindrahomestays.com/homestays/Pages/Ooty.aspx">Ooty</a>:</strong> Ooty is known as ‘the queen of the Blue Mountains’ and is a beautiful hill station located in the Nilgiris. It is known for its beautiful gardens, wooded rolling hills, pine and eucalyptus forests, coffee and tea plantations, ancient tribes and monuments.</p>
<p><a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/File:Ooty_Town.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-4061" title="Ooty_Town" src="http://blog.mahindrahomestays.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/12/Ooty_Town.jpg" alt="Ooty_Town" width="350" height="235" /></a></p>
<p><strong><a href="http://www.mahindrahomestays.com/homestays/Pages/Coonoor.aspx">Coonoor</a>:</strong> Coonoor is the second highest hillstation in Nilgiris and it is perched at a height of 1,856 meters above sea level.Coonoor is a haven for bird lovers; it&#8217;s home to songbirds like nightingales, babblers, larks and robins.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.flickr.com/photos/enchant_me/144982866/"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-4062" title="Coonoor" src="http://blog.mahindrahomestays.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/12/144982866_fc7a3531d6_z.jpg" alt="Coonoor" width="350" height="263" /></a></p>
<p><strong><a href="http://www.mahindrahomestays.com/homestays/Pages/Yercaud.aspx">Yercaud</a>:</strong> Located near Salem in Tamil Nadu’s Servarayan range at an altitude of 1,500 meters is Yercaud. The hills here are rich with fauna and flora, which includes bison, deer, rabbits, hares, and many others. The Yercaud Lake is surrounded by well-groomed gardens and thick trees.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.flickr.com/photos/anshad/5277321966/"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-4063" title="Yercaud" src="http://blog.mahindrahomestays.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/12/5277321966_0bcc3194c9.jpg" alt="Yercaud" width="350" height="233" /></a></p>
<p><strong><a href="http://www.mahindrahomestays.com/homestays/Pages/bangalore.aspx">Bangalore</a>:</strong> This young city boasts of a rich history. From ancient temples to popular nightclubs, Bangalore has it all. Some of the most important temples here are the dravidian Bull Temple, the ISKCON Temple and a Hanuman Temple. Houses of meditation and spirituality such as the world renowned Art of Living Foundation have an ashram here.</p>
<p>For the family ideal parks are Cubbon Park, a green oasis apread in over 300 acres. For wildlife lovers the Bannerghatta National Park is a great place to spot migrating elephants, bison, wild boar and if one is extremely lucky, the elusive leopard as well.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.flickr.com/photos/s_w_ellis/3831672217/"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-4064" title="Hanuman temple" src="http://blog.mahindrahomestays.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/12/3831672217_7abffb446e.jpg" alt="Hanuman temple" width="350" height="467" /></a></p>
<p><strong>Mysore:</strong> Mysore is known as the &#8216;city of palaces&#8217; and here one can find the Ambavilas Palace also known as the Mysore Palace, the Jaganmohana Palace, the Jayalakshmi Vilas and the Lalitha Mahal. Chamundeshwari Temple, which is perched on the Chamundi Hills is a revered shrine.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>If you are in Bangalore and want to escape the city for the weekend there are plenty of easily accessible options. Here is a list of our favourite hill station breaks for getting away from it all.</p>
<p><a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/File:Tadiandamol_Pan.jpg"><strong><span style="font-weight: normal;"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-2757" title="coorg" src="http://blog.mahindrahomestays.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/05/coorg.jpg" alt="coorg" width="500" height="224" /></span></strong></a></p>
<p><strong><span style="font-weight: normal;"> </span>Coorg</strong></p>
<p>Nestled in south-west Karnataka lies <a href="http://www.mahindrahomestays.com/homestays/Pages/coorg.aspx">Coorg</a>, a small hillstation that’s often called ‘The Scotland of the East’. In Mercara or Madikeri, one finds the proud Madikeri Fort, which was built in 17th century. Here, the Raja&#8217;s Seat overlooks a deep valley and from here you can enjoy spectacular views of the sunrise and sunset. At the Abbey Falls water cascades to a depth of 70 feet into a rocky valley offering an unforgettable sight to visitors.</p>
<p>Tadiyendamol is the loftiest peak in Coorg challenging people to climb it. Located on the banks of the river Cauvery is the Valnoor Fishing Camp where avid fishing enthusiasts can indulge in the luxury of angling for the huge game fish mahseer. Over 5000 monks reside at the Namdroling Monastery in Bylakuppe and it is one of the largest Tibetan settlements in the country.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.flickr.com/photos/poornakedar/3964873311/"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-2758" title="wayanad" src="http://blog.mahindrahomestays.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/05/wayanad.jpg" alt="wayanad" width="500" height="334" /></a></p>
<p><strong>Wayanad</strong></p>
<p>This hill station is located in the northern part of Kerala. Its natural beauty has been left intact as it hasn’t been overrun by tourism. <a href="http://www.mahindrahomestays.com/homestays/Pages/wayanad.aspx">Wayanad</a> is largely covered by spice plantations, paddy fields and forests. The region’s landscape is speckled with beautiful trekking trails. One important trail is the 10 hour climb to the top of the 2100m Chembra Peak, the highest point in Wayanad.</p>
<p>One of the main attractions is the Wayanad Wildlife Sanctuary where it is possible to see deer, bears, macaques, elephants and even tigers. Other attractions include the ancient Sree Thirunelli and Valliyurkava Bhagavathi temples and the 5000 year old prehistoric rock-art in the Edakkal Caves.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.flickr.com/photos/seeveeaar/3155603837/"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-2759" title="ooty" src="http://blog.mahindrahomestays.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/05/ooty.jpg" alt="ooty" width="500" height="357" /></a></p>
<p><strong>Ooty</strong></p>
<p><a href="http://www.mahindrahomestays.com/homestays/Pages/Ooty.aspx">Ooty</a> is known as ‘the queen of the Blue Mountains’ and is a beautiful hill station located in the Nilgiris. It is known for beautiful gardens, wooded rolling hills, pine and eucalyptus forests, coffee and tea plantations, ancient tribes and monuments. Ooty’s Botanical Gardens has developed over the last 150 years, and offers over 2,000 species of flowering plants.</p>
<p>A popular spot amongst families is the Ooty lake. This is an artificial lake, which was constructed in the early 1800’s.</p>
<p>Doddabetta is the highest peak in the Western Ghats and it stands at a height of 8,640 ft above sea level. It is accessible by road and the drive offers panoramic views of the surrounding ranges and valleys. Ten minutes from the Ooty Market is a Toda Village. The Todas are one of the oldest tribes to inhabit this region and you will find beautiful Toda temples in the area. For those who want to shop, handicrafts can be purchased right from the village at great prices.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.flickr.com/photos/maintenancepic/4381183382/"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-2778" title="coonoor" src="http://blog.mahindrahomestays.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/05/coonoor1.jpg" alt="coonoor" width="500" height="332" /></a></p>
<p><strong>Coonoor</strong></p>
<p><a href="http://www.mahindrahomestays.com/homestays/Pages/Coonoor.aspx">Coonoor</a> is the second highest hillstation in Nilgiris and it is perched at a height of 1,856 meters above sea level. Sim’s Park in Coonoor is located at an altitude of 1798 meters and is nestled in a deep ravine. The park is famous for great views to many of Coonoor’s popular tourist spots such as Lamb&#8217;s Rock, Dolphin&#8217;s Nose and Lady Canning&#8217;s Seat.</p>
<p>Nilgiri’s famous Toy Train is a great way to reach Coonoor. The charming train started operating over a century ago and maneuvers the rocky terrain with ease. Many songbirds like nightingales, babblers, larks and robins, whoare found in Coonoor. The Pomological Station is a feast for those interested in horticulture. Many varieties of fruits are grown here for research purposes. The Law Falls are located 7 kilometers from Coonoor and water here drops from a height of almost 200 feet.</p>
<p><a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/File:Yercaud_lake.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-2761" title="yercaud" src="http://blog.mahindrahomestays.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/05/yercaud.jpg" alt="yercaud" width="500" height="256" /></a></p>
<p><strong>Yercaud</strong></p>
<p>Located near Salem in Tamil Nadu’s Servarayan range at an altitude of 1,500 meters is <a href="http://www.mahindrahomestays.com/homestays/Pages/Yercaud.aspx">Yercaud</a>. Yercaud’s highest point is the Servarayan temple, which is perched at a height of 5326 feet. The hills here are rich with fauna and flora, which includes bison, deer, rabbits, hares, and many other native species. The Yercaud Lake is surrounded by well-groomed gardens and thick trees. One of the best views that Yercaud can offer is at the Lady&#8217;s Seat. Panoramic view of the ghats and beyond can be seen from here. Stargazing is a lovely experience at the Lady’s Seat.</p>
<p>The Kiliyur Falls in Yercaus fall from a majestic height of 90 feet andare popular amongst visitors.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>If you are in Mumbai and fancy a weekend getaway then make sure you consider Goa and Sindhudurg. Either makes a great break that is easily accessible from Mumbai.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.flickr.com/photos/klausnahr/4295222128/"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-2732" title="goa" src="http://blog.mahindrahomestays.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/05/goa.jpg" alt="goa" width="500" height="375" /></a></p>
<p><a href="http://www.flickr.com/photos/klausnahr/4295222128/"><strong>Goa</strong></a><br />
One of India’s top tourist destinations, Goa is located just 580 kms from Mumbai. People can just hop into their cars and leave the stresses of big city living behind. There are over 40 mesmerizing beaches which dot the 131 km-long coastline of Goa. Some of the most popular amongst them are Colva, Calangute, Baga, Anjuna, Miramar, Vagator, Dona Paula, Majorda and Bambolim. Goa turns into a riot of colours and music during the annual Goa Carnival. From bohemian shacks to the ultimate in high end resorts, and everything in between, Goa caters to beach lovers of all kinds. Some beaches like Mandrem are perfectly serene while others like Anjuna are the toast of the party circuit.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.mahindrahomestays.com/homestays/Pages/Goa.aspx">Find out more about Goa and search for a homestay</a></p>
<p><a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/File:Sindhudurg_fort.JPG"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-2733" title="Sindhudurg_fort" src="http://blog.mahindrahomestays.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/05/Sindhudurg_fort.JPG" alt="Sindhudurg_fort" width="500" height="238" /></a></p>
<p><a href=" http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/File:Sindhudurg_fort.JPG"><strong>Sindhudurg</strong></a><br />
Sindhudurg is the southernmost district of Maharashtra and stretches for about 125 kilometers along the Arabian Sea. It is situated 500 kilometers from Mumbai and is famous for the Sindhudurg Fort. The Fort was built three by Shivaji is a symbol of the Maratha naval power during his reign. The 48 acre Sindhudurg Fort can be reached by boat. Snorkeling sessions around the Fort are organized by the government. In Sidhudurg one finds the Tarkarli beach which is often called ‘the Tahiti of India’. This white sandy, sun-kissed beach open up to emerald-green waters.</p>
